Evil Within series free on Epic Game Store

The Evil Within and The Evil Within 2 are survival horror video games developed by Tango Gameworks and published by Bethesda Softworks. These games are or will soon be out for grabs on Epic Game Store. 

The Evil Within was released in 2014 and directed by Shinji Mikami, the creator of the Resident Evil series. The game received praise for its visuals, atmosphere and gameplay, but some criticism for its story and characters. The game features five difficulty modes, a crafting system, and a customization system that allows players to upgrade Sebastian’s abilities and weapons. The game also has three DLCs that expand on the story and gameplay.

Evil Within & Evil Within 2

The Evil Within 2 was released in 2017 and directed by John Johanas, who worked on the DLCs of the first game. The game received generally positive reviews, and improved on many aspects of the first game, such as the map design, the stealth mechanics, and the narrative. The game also added a first-person perspective option in a free update. The game continues Sebastian’s journey as he tries to rescue his daughter Lily from the world of Union, a new STEM environment.

If you are interested in playing these games, you can get them for free on the Epic Games Store. The Evil Within is currently available until October 26, 2023, and The Evil Within 2 will be available from October 26 to November 2, 2023. You will need an Epic Games account to claim.
